最近在做一个项目,是一个网站,最近可能会陆陆续续的记录下自己在这个项目中遇到的问题,首先先说下支付。这个网站需要实现在pc浏览器、微信公众号和手机浏览器中打开了,我们用的支付方式是微信支付,因为之前只是做了pc端的扫码支付,现在需要实现后者也能支付。首先在微信公众号里面的支付我们用的是JSAPI支付,手机浏览器中我们使用的是H5支付,关于在微信商户平台申请部分以及配置啥的我也不多说了(因为具体我也
H5 支付是指商户在微信客户端外的移动端网页展示商品或服务,用户在前述页面确认使用微信支付时,商户发起本服务呼起微信客户端进行支付。主要用于触屏版的手机浏览器请求微信支付的场景。可以方便的从外部浏览器唤起微信支付。可能很多人对 微信 H5 支付都不熟悉,那我们先说下公众号和 APP 微信支付,顾名思义,就是在微信公众号内和 APP 里接入微信支付,当用户在公众号网页或者 APP 内购买商品时,可以
转载
2023-09-18 04:59:23
249阅读
微信H5支付整理官方 流程图 https://pay.weixin.qq.com/wiki/doc/api/H5.php?chapter=15_3官方案例 http://wxpay.wxutil.com/mch/pay/h5.v2.php首先要申请开通微信H5支付开通中可能会遇到的问题:(1)网站域名ICP备案主体与商户号主体不一致。解决版本:申请域名的授权即可。开通成功后H5
场景在微信H5页面(使用 vue-router2 控制路由的 vue2 单页应用项目)中使用微信 jssdk 进行微信支付。基本知识1.依据微信jssdk官方文档,使用微信功能的页面,必须进行微信 config,并在wx ready 之后再调用微信功能。 2.进行微信支付的话,需要在微信开放平台配置微信支付合法路径。该合法路径有层级限制,比如需要支付的页面的url为 https://example
【支付方式】我开发的项目中只对接了最基础的三项,微信h5,支付宝h5,以及由于微信内打开链接不可用微信h5支付而采取的微信公众号支付【准备】1. 申请微信公众号,配置域名并拿到appid2. 了解微信获取code和openid的方式,和后端商量获取方案这里我们采取的方案是,前端在点击支付按钮时获取code传递给后端,由后端去获取openid。之所以在点击支付时才获取是因为code有五分钟的时效性,
最近做了一个答题应用,甲方要求,用户进入应用先答题,最后点微信支付的时候,再授权,支付。我的实现思路是点击微信支付按钮时,跳转到某个地址获取授权redirect_uri 需要先在微信公众号后台支付授权目录里设置,需要跳转的路由,前台也应该存在 xxx/pay。由于支付目录不允许hash地址,vue路由模式需要设置为history模式handlePayMoney() {
if (isWX
在微信支付已经霸占了大部分人生活习惯的年代,一个不支持微信支付的商家都不好意思开店了,程序猿们可以下载查看HTML5微信支付DEMO来帮助您熟悉微信支付的代码,马上下载查看微信h5支付 demo的内容吧HTML5微信支付DEMO基本说明微信支付是集成在微信客户端的支付功能,用户可以通过手机完成快速的支付流程。微信支付以绑定银行卡的快捷支付为基础,向用户提供安全、快捷、高效的支付服务,目前微信支付已
说明微信支付提供的方式有很多种,但是本文讲的是H5支付,其他支付的实现方式其实大同小异 H5支付是指商户在微信客户端外的移动端网页展示商品或服务,用户在前述页面确认使用微信支付时,商户发起本服务呼起微信客户端进行支付。主要用于触屏版的手机浏览器请求微信支付的场景。可以方便的从外部浏览器唤起微信支付。微信官方支付的开发文档https://pay.weixin.qq.com/wiki/doc/api/
1、用户在商户侧完成下单,使用微信支付进行支付2、由商户后台向微信支付发起下单请求注:交易类型trade_type=MWEB3、统一下单接口返回支付相关参数给商户后台,如支付跳转url(参数名“mweb_url”),商户通过mweb_url调起微信支付中间页4、中间页进行H5权限的校验,安全性检查(此处常见错误请见下文)5、如支付成功,商户后台会接收到微信侧的异步通知6、用户在微信支付收银台完成支
好久没有更新博客,最近做项目遇到了微信支付,整理一下需求,目的一个活动页面需要调微信支付!应用框架THINKPHP5.1注意:微信支付需要注意如果是h5页面调取支付的话,需要静默一个登录状态获取code,这样才可以保证支付调取的参数openid正常,这里的坑填了好久,微信内浏览器h5用户输入完手机号登录后,页面存cookie信息,有时候会不更新获取的openid导致“下单账号和支付账号不一致,请核
原创
2019-12-10 16:50:39
3078阅读
一、h5页面支付h5页面接入微信支付分为两种情况,一种微信内置浏览器调用支付,另一种是在外置浏览器调用支付内置浏览器支付内置浏览器支付使用JSAPI支付前端调用代码wx.chooseWXPay({
timestamp: 0, // 支付签名时间戳,注意微信 jssdk 中的所有使用 timestamp 字段均为小写。但最新版的支付后台生成签名使用的 timeStamp 字段名需大写其中的 S
一、准备材料微信商户参数,例:appid、mch_id...微信SDK,下载地址:https://pay.weixin.qq.com/wiki/doc/api/jsapi.php?chapter=11_1
去了解一下微信支付的流程注:下载完sdk mvn install jar包就行了,最后在maven引入或直接复制进lib二、编代码/**
* @Description H5调起微信支付
之前的文章「微信支付申请相关问题」里说过微信公众号和 APP 申请微信支付,今天来说下微信 H5 支付的申请。一、背景介绍H5 支付是指商户在微信客户端外的移动端网页展示商品或服务,用户在前述页面确认使用微信支付时,商户发起本服务呼起微信客户端进行支付。主要用于触屏版的手机浏览器请求微信支付的场景。可以方便的从外部浏览器唤起微信支付。微信官方体验链接:https://wxpay.wxutil.co
# 实现ios h5微信支付教程
## 一、流程概述
为了实现ios h5微信支付,需要通过微信官方提供的JSAPI接口实现,整体流程如下:
| 步骤 | 操作 |
| ---- | ---- |
| 1 | 引入微信JSAPI |
| 2 | 获取微信支付参数 |
| 3 | 调用微信支付接口 |
## 二、具体步骤
### 1. 引入微信JSAPI
在html页面中引入微信JSAPI,
最近做的 SPA 网站集成了微信支付,使用的是微信 H5 调起支付API接口。做完后对微信 H5 支付的流程有了进一步的了解,在前后端调试接口的过程中也遇到了一些问题,在这里记录下来。支付流程在订单页 ajax 请求后端发起下单,后端挂起请求后端根据订单号结合微信支付相关配置参数向微信服务器发起统一下单
下单成功,微信通知前面传递的 notify_url,返回 prepay_id (预支付交易会话
(首先 写一句哈 这里的代码是很清楚很清楚了, 仔细检查 返回的报错信息 检查你的配置文件,返回错误的地方以后问这些 很LOW 的话题的 请自觉发100块,我也要做事情的。。。不是帮你解决BUG的。) 当然 作为同行互相我还是比较喜欢的 留Q 303558498老久没写的DEMO 了 最近上了一个项目要调取支付 要用H5 非浏览器
前言近期一直在使用APP开发多端应用,IOS的APP、安卓的APP和H5网页,其中开发的APP使用到了微信和支付宝的支付,在此给大家分享出来,一起使用前置条件:开发环境:windows开发框架:uni-app , H5+,nativeJS编辑器:HbuilderX 2.8.13 4.兼容版本:安卓,IOS已作测试此代码可以直接复制到uni-app项目中使用正文开始:1. 首
首先判断,是在微信中打开还是非微信打开,非微信打开,创建订单式,判断选择支付宝支付,还是微信支付支付宝支付:请求后端给的api,传入订单号,或者你们自定义的参数,然后请求成功后返回的地址是后端直接配置的,支付成功后跳转相应的界面, 注意:判断有无支付宝app,是支付宝自己的界面测试地址 :https://wxh5.hyxhbao.com/home//支付宝app支付
t
业务场景介绍H5移动端支持微信支付 [ 微信支付分为微信内支付(JSAPI支付官方API)和微信外支付(H5支付官方API)] && 支付宝支付 [手机网站支付转 APP 支付 官方API ]订单生成逻辑:前端请求后端提交订单,后端去和微信或者支付宝对接生成订单(后续支付都是这个逻辑进行的对接1 .vue微信支付微信支付又分为微信内支付和微信外支付流程如下1.在订单组件中选择支付方
<!DOCTYPE html><html lang="en"> <head> <meta charset="UTF-8"> <meta name="viewport" content="width=device-width, initial-scale=1.0"> <title>微信支付</titl
转载
2022-06-28 04:42:32
321阅读